diff --git a/HISTORY b/HISTORY index 4dbd43f3..c0b855d2 100644 --- a/HISTORY +++ b/HISTORY @@ -4968,3 +4968,4 @@ Video Disk Recorder Revision History Petri Hintukainen). - Fixed handling plugins from cRemote::PutMacro() and cRemote::CallPlugin() (based on a patch from Petri Hintukainen). +- Increased the size of the key queue to avoid problems with long key macros. diff --git a/remote.h b/remote.h index e5b80b2c..4477666b 100644 --- a/remote.h +++ b/remote.h @@ -4,7 +4,7 @@ * See the main source file 'vdr.c' for copyright information and * how to reach the author. * - * $Id: remote.h 1.36 2006/10/14 10:56:50 kls Exp $ + * $Id: remote.h 1.37 2006/10/14 11:46:58 kls Exp $ */ #ifndef __REMOTE_H @@ -19,7 +19,7 @@ class cRemote : public cListObject { private: - enum { MaxKeys = MAXKEYSINMACRO }; + enum { MaxKeys = 2 * MAXKEYSINMACRO }; static eKeys keys[MaxKeys]; static int in; static int out;